Compatibility • Mega Bass® (On/Off) Sound System • CD Play Modes (Program/Shuffle/Repeat) • 30 Station Memory Presets (10AM/20FM) • 20 Track RMS Programming • Synchronized CD/Cassette Dubbing • Stereo Record/Playback Cassette Deck • Also Available In Psyc® Product Colors v Step-up Feature ◗ New Feature CFD-E90 CD Radio Cassette Recorder
